One of the reporter reported me that he is not able to build x11/libxcb as it requires xcb-proto >= 1.5 but port doesn't tell him to do so. The attached diff fixes this. How-To-Repeat: 1. Make sure x11/xcb-proto < 1.5 is installed. 2. Now upgrade or install x11/libxcb port. # make -C /usr/ports/x11/libxcb build deinstall install clean 3. You'll get an error something like given below in config.log: configure:12436: $? = 1 Requested 'xcb-proto >= 1.5' but version of XCB Proto is 1.n configure:12464: error: Package requirements (xcb-proto >= 1.5) were not met: Requested 'xcb-proto >= 1.5' but version of XCB Proto is 1.n Consider adjusting the PKG_CONFIG_PATH environment variable if you installed software in a non-standard prefix. Alternatively, you may set the environment variables XCBPROTO_CFLAGS and XCBPROTO_LIBS to avoid the need to call pkg-config. See the pkg-config man page for more details.
